Ladakh
April indicators the start of apricot blossom season in Ladakh, when villages throughout the Sham Valley and areas round Leh are briefly remodeled by delicate pink and white blooms. This short-lived spectacle coincides with reopening landscapes after winter, providing clear views, fewer crowds and a uncommon glimpse of on a regular basis life earlier than the height summer time rush. Monasteries reopen, roads step by step grow to be accessible and the area feels poised between seasons.
The Nilgiris, Tamil Nadu
Before the summer time vacation crowds arrive in May, April is among the most nice months to discover the Nilgiris. Hill stations equivalent to Ooty and Coonoor stay cool, with flowering gardens, tea estates and forested strolling trails at their most inviting. The season is good for sluggish journey, heritage practice rides on the Nilgiri Mountain Railway, plantation stays and lengthy drives by way of misty slopes, providing respite from rising temperatures throughout a lot of southern India.
